What are the most innovative GIS applications for environmental risk assessment?
Environmental risk assessment is the process of identifying, analyzing, and evaluating the potential impacts of natural or human-induced hazards on the environment and human health. Geographic information systems (GIS) are powerful tools that can help environmental engineers and managers to perform this task more efficiently and effectively. GIS can integrate, manipulate, and visualize various types of spatial and temporal data, such as land use, climate, population, pollution, and vulnerability.
